Biko

  • Prep time 40 mins
  • Servings 12

Ingredients

1 cup glutinous rice

1 cup water

3 pandan leaves

2 cups light coconut milk

1 cup So Good Soy Regular Milk

1/2 cup coconut sugar

Pinch of salt

Grape seed oil (for lining your pan)

Method

  1. Pre-heat oven to 200 degrees Celsius.
  2. Rinse and strain your glutinous rice
  3. Place 1/2 cup of water, 1 cup coconut milk, and the glutinous rice into a pot with the pandan leaves. Bring to a boil then simmer for 5 minutes.
  4. In a separate pan, add in 1 cup coconut milk, So Good Soy Regular Milk, coconut sugar and salt.
  5. Mix and bring to a boil and simmer for 5-10 minutes or until thick.
  6. Remove the pandan leaves from the rice, add in most of the sauce mixture, leaving some for the top, and mix until well incorporated.
  7. Oil or butter a baking pan and transfer the rice mixture and spread evenly.
  8. Pour in the rest of the sauce and spread.
  9. Place in the oven and bake for 20-30 minutes.
